Why Do Parents Protect the Child Who Keeps Hurting the Family?

Have you ever noticed that in some families, the person creating the most chaos also seems to get the most protection?

They lie.

They steal.

They relapse.

They manipulate.

They explode.

They betray trust.

And somehow, everyone else is expected to adjust around them.

If you're the sibling who's always been told to "be the bigger person," this can leave you feeling completely confused.

You're sitting there thinking:

"Wait a second...they're the one who caused all of this. Why am I the one being pressured?"

If that sounds familiar, you're not imagining it.

There's a reason this happens, and surprisingly, it isn't always because your parents love your sibling more.

It Isn't Always Favoritism

From the outside, this dynamic can look like obvious favoritism.

Sometimes it is.

But many times, something else is happening.
